Keep in mind that some targets don't support the full audio resolution in recording mode. The Sansa e200 devices are one of these and you are limited to 22khz stereo. Whereas FM has an upper resolution limit of ~32khz.
I actually pondered a feature like this and posted it elsewhere on these forums but it has a lot of considerations and speedbumps.